we have the work senator grassley and i have done on pay for delay. one court case helped with that but there's more work that can be done and i believe if we put that up for a vote on the senate floor in any which way, we would get that done. as you know that is when the generics to keep their products up the market. we have problems of product hopping and which the pharmaceutical companies force patients with an established drug with an expiring patent to a new drug with a new patent often with little or no therapeutic difference just to avoid competition from generic. that is a bill our friend senator cornyn and blumenthal can get at that. just before a generic is going to come on the market, the brand that filed the petitions as it isn't a safe, slows it down and that is another bill senator grassley and i have to do something about. other solutions, senator lee and i worked together on a bill to allow the importation of drugs and certain circumstances when there are issues with pricing. senator grassley and i have another bill to do that more per

grassley: i ask that the calling of the quorum be suspended. the presiding officer: without objection. mr. grassley: every state of the nation has many infrastructure needs. in iowa, we rely on our roads, bridges, air, and freight to move our goods and people throughout iowa, throughout the united states, and eventually throughout the world. i'm encouraged that a bipartisan framework has been agreed to for moving forward on an infrastructure bill. i'll be interested in seeing more details about the policy and the way to pay for the bill, as the bill proceeds forward. today i would like to discuss one aspect of infrastructure, and that's our inland waterways. for iowa, that's the mississippi and missouri rivers. for other states, it's a lot of other important rivers. i ask my colleagues to take this important mode of transportation into account as they work on legislation. i've also sent this request in letter to both the senate environment and public works as well as the appropriations committees. the inland and intercoastal waterways and our p
